These chemical groups affect a hormone’s distribution, the type of receptors it binds to, … Web28 apr. 2024 · Hydrophobic literally means “the fear of water”. Hydrophobic molecules and surfaces repel water. Hydrophobic liquids, such as oil, will separate from water. WebHydrophobic interaction chromatography (HIC) separates molecules based on their hydrophobicity. HIC is a useful separation technique for purifying proteins while … WebHydrophobic interaction chromatography can be used for capture, intermediate purification, or polishing steps. Samples should be in a high salt concentration to promote hydrophobic interaction.
